NORTH BEACH TOWN CENTER
The North Beach Town Center, bounded by 73 Street on the north, Collins Avenue on the east, 69 Street on the south and Indian Creek waterway on the west, is an area where the City of Miami Beach encourages redevelopment of existing properties with a vibrant mixture of retail, restaurant, entertainment, office and residential uses. The concept plan for the North Beach Town Center was adopted by the Mayor and Commission in 2007. This was followed by an amendment to the Comprehensive Plan and the adoption of three Town Center "TC" zoning districts in 2011. Explore the following links for details.
